Hey there, I’m Stephanie.

I was most recently a designer and developer at San Francisco Chronicle working on digital news products and interactive stories. My work there has been recognized by the Online News Association, Society for News Design and Pulitzers. Before that, I studied journalism, computer science and design at Northwestern University. I’ve also designed for The Boston Globe and CalMatters.

Like every person with a journalism background ever, I tell people I love telling stories. But more specifically, I want to combine research and analysis skills I learned from journalism with technology to create experiences that are thoughtful and delightful.

What this looks like is different day-to-day and can be confusing to explain, but at the core of it all, I just want to make cool things.
